# Copyright (c) Facebook, Inc. and its affiliates.
#
# This source code is licensed under the MIT license found in the
# LICENSE file in the root directory of this source tree.
from abc import ABC, abstractmethod
from dataclasses import dataclass
from typing import Tuple
from libcst._add_slots import add_slots
from libcst._base_visitor import CSTVisitor
from libcst.nodes._base import BaseLeaf, CSTNode, CSTValidationError
from libcst.nodes._internal import CodegenState, visit_required
from libcst.nodes._whitespace import BaseParenthesizableWhitespace, SimpleWhitespace
class _BaseOneTokenOp(CSTNode, ABC):
"""
Any node that has a static value and needs to own whitespace on both sides.
"""
whitespace_before: BaseParenthesizableWhitespace
whitespace_after: BaseParenthesizableWhitespace
def _visit_and_replace_children(self, visitor: CSTVisitor) -> "_BaseOneTokenOp":
return self.__class__(
whitespace_before=visit_required(
"whitespace_before", self.whitespace_before, visitor
),
whitespace_after=visit_required(
"whitespace_after", self.whitespace_after, visitor
),
)
def _codegen_impl(self, state: CodegenState) -> None:
self.whitespace_before._codegen(state)
state.add_token(self._get_token())
self.whitespace_after._codegen(state)
@abstractmethod
def _get_token(self) -> str:
...
class _BaseTwoTokenOp(CSTNode, ABC):
"""
This node ends up as two tokens, so we must preserve the whitespace
in beteween them.
"""
whitespace_before: BaseParenthesizableWhitespace
whitespace_between: BaseParenthesizableWhitespace
whitespace_after: BaseParenthesizableWhitespace
def _validate(self) -> None:
if self.whitespace_between.empty:
raise CSTValidationError("Must have at least one space between not and in.")
def _visit_and_replace_children(self, visitor: CSTVisitor) -> "_BaseTwoTokenOp":
return self.__class__(
whitespace_before=visit_required(
"whitespace_before", self.whitespace_before, visitor
),
whitespace_between=visit_required(
"whitespace_between", self.whitespace_between, visitor
),
whitespace_after=visit_required(
"whitespace_after", self.whitespace_after, visitor
),
)
def _codegen_impl(self, state: CodegenState) -> None:
self.whitespace_before._codegen(state)
state.add_token(self._get_tokens()[0])
self.whitespace_between._codegen(state)
state.add_token(self._get_tokens()[1])
self.whitespace_after._codegen(state)
@abstractmethod
def _get_tokens(self) -> Tuple[str, str]:
...
class BaseUnaryOp(CSTNode, ABC):
"""
Any node that has a static value used in a Unary expression.
"""
whitespace_after: BaseParenthesizableWhitespace
def _visit_and_replace_children(self, visitor: CSTVisitor) -> "BaseUnaryOp":
return self.__class__(
whitespace_after=visit_required(
"whitespace_after", self.whitespace_after, visitor
)
)
def _codegen_impl(self, state: CodegenState) -> None:
state.add_token(self._get_token())
self.whitespace_after._codegen(state)
@abstractmethod
def _get_token(self) -> str:
...
class BaseBooleanOp(_BaseOneTokenOp, ABC):
"""
Any node that has a static value used in a Binary expression. This node
is purely for typing.
"""
class BaseBinaryOp(CSTNode, ABC):
"""
Any node that has a static value used in a Binary expression. This node
is purely for typing.
"""
class BaseCompOp(CSTNode, ABC):
"""
Any node that has a static value used in a CompExpression. This node
is purely for typing.
"""
class BaseAugOp(CSTNode, ABC):
"""
Any node that has a static value used in an AugAssign. This node is purely
for typing.
"""
@add_slots
@dataclass(frozen=True)
class Semicolon(_BaseOneTokenOp):
"""
Used by SmallStatement as a separator between subsequent SmallStatements contained
within a SimpleStatementLine or SimpleStatementSuite.
"""
whitespace_before: BaseParenthesizableWhitespace = SimpleWhitespace("")
whitespace_after: BaseParenthesizableWhitespace = SimpleWhitespace("")
def _get_token(self) -> str:
return ";"
@add_slots
@dataclass(frozen=True)
class Colon(_BaseOneTokenOp):
"""
Used by Slice as a separator between subsequent Expressions, and in Lambda
to separate arguments and body.
"""
whitespace_before: BaseParenthesizableWhitespace = SimpleWhitespace("")
whitespace_after: BaseParenthesizableWhitespace = SimpleWhitespace("")
def _get_token(self) -> str:
return ":"
@add_slots
@dataclass(frozen=True)
class Comma(_BaseOneTokenOp):
"""
Syntactic trivia used as a separator between subsequent items in various parts of
the grammar.
Some use-cases are:
- Import or ImportFrom
- Function arguments
- Tuple/list/set/dict elements
"""
whitespace_before: BaseParenthesizableWhitespace = SimpleWhitespace("")
whitespace_after: BaseParenthesizableWhitespace = SimpleWhitespace("")
def _get_token(self) -> str:
return ","
@add_slots
@dataclass(frozen=True)
class Dot(_BaseOneTokenOp):
"""
Used by Attribute and DottedName as a separator between subsequent
Name nodes.
"""
whitespace_before: BaseParenthesizableWhitespace = SimpleWhitespace("")
whitespace_after: BaseParenthesizableWhitespace = SimpleWhitespace("")
def _get_token(self) -> str:
return "."
@add_slots
@dataclass(frozen=True)
class ImportStar(BaseLeaf):
"""
Used by ImportFrom to denote a star import.
"""
def _codegen_impl(self, state: CodegenState) -> None:
state.add_token("*")
@add_slots
@dataclass(frozen=True)
class AssignEqual(_BaseOneTokenOp):
"""
Used by AnnAssign to denote a single equal character when doing an
assignment on top of a type annotation.
"""
whitespace_before: BaseParenthesizableWhitespace = SimpleWhitespace(" ")
whitespace_after: BaseParenthesizableWhitespace = SimpleWhitespace(" ")
def _get_token(self) -> str:
return "="
